Milford Center village is a Census village of 770 people across 0.42 square miles of land, in Union County. Median household income is $93,125, 82.4 percent of occupied homes are owned.

How many people live in Milford Center, Ohio?
770, in 245 households. Milford Center village covers 0.42 square miles of land, which is 1,826 people per square mile.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.
What county is Milford Center in?
Union County, which holds 100.0 percent of the place by area. Source: US Census Bureau, cartographic boundary file, places, 2024 vintage.
What is the median household income in Milford Center?
$93,125. The median owner-occupied home is valued at $197,100. Median gross rent is $1,438 per month.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.
Is Milford Center in the National Flood Insurance Program?
Yes. Milford Center appears in the FEMA Community Status Book as community 390662, with no Community Rating System class, so no CRS discount applies. Whether a specific parcel sits in a mapped special flood hazard area is an address level question the platform answers.
